Cardiff City Defeats Wrexham 2-1 to Reach Carabao Cup Quarter-Finals
Cardiff City secured a 2-1 victory over Wrexham in the Carabao Cup fourth round, advancing to the quarter-finals for the first time since the 2011-12 season. Will Fish, a former Manchester United academy player signed by Cardiff for £1 million, scored the decisive volleyed winner, marking his first goal for the club and ending Cardiff's 21-year winless streak against Wrexham. Wrexham equalized through substitute Kieffer Moore, but their overall lackluster first-half performance and inability to maintain momentum led to their defeat. Cardiff dominated possession and created numerous chances, with Yousef Salech opening the scoring early on and Rubin Colwill impressing despite hitting the crossbar. The match highlighted contrasting priorities, with Wrexham focusing on Championship survival and Cardiff aiming for promotion from League One. Fish's goal not only secured Cardiff's win but also underscored his growing importance at the club, with Manchester United retaining a buy-back clause and a sell-on fee in his transfer.
